Related Product Features:
Features a plug-and-play design that connects directly to the DJI Matrice 400 via the E-Port interface with no additional cables or brackets required.
Utilizes an advanced deployment algorithm with attitude, acceleration, rotation, and free-fall sensors to detect abnormal flight states in milliseconds.
Deploys a parachute instantly when triggered, reducing descent speed to a safe 4-5.5 m/s for ground impact mitigation.
Includes integrated high-visibility RGB warning lights that flash automatically during emergency descent or nighttime operations.
Built with a reusable modular structure where only consumable components need replacement after deployment, reducing operational costs.
Incorporates multi-layer redundancy including electronic fuse protection, dual-sensor monitoring, and mechanical release for maximum reliability.
Designed for quick installation with a high-strength mount compatible with DJI M400 drones, enabling instant field deployment.
Operates effectively across a wide temperature range from -20°C to 60°C and altitudes from -150 m to 4000 m.
FAQs:
How is the DPS-Y400 parachute system installed on the DJI Matrice 400?
The DPS-Y400 features a quick-mount architecture that connects directly through the drone's native E-Port interface, requiring no pre-assembly, additional cables, or brackets for a plug-and-play installation.
What triggers the parachute deployment in an emergency?
The system autonomously triggers deployment when its built-in sensors detect abnormal flight states such as attitude anomalies, free-fall, stall, or collision, using an advanced algorithm for millisecond response.
Is the entire system replaced after a parachute deployment?
No, the DPS-Y400 has a reusable modular design. After deployment, only the consumable components need replacement, not the entire assembly, which significantly reduces operational costs for fleet operations.
What safety redundancies does the Y400 system include?
The system incorporates multi-layer redundancy including electronic fuse protection, dual-sensor monitoring, power-cut detection with 10ms response, and mechanical release to ensure reliable deployment even under extreme conditions.
